Well ATM actually stands for asynchronous transfer mode and is often defined as a traditional cell centered switching method that specifically uses asynchronous time division multiplexing which enables encoding of specific data into specific sized cells or cell relay and provides distinct data link layer services which particularly run on OSI Layer 1 physical links. Most often individuals confuse it with packet switched networks like the Internet Protocol or Ethernet where different sized small-scale packets are utilized for data transfer.
ATM or asynchronous transfer mode generally includes elements of both varieties of networking. This means that it can be utilized in each of circuit switched in addition to packet switched networking. This permits it to operate as the ideal means of a wide range of data transfer. It is also very suitable for real time media transport. The design that is particularly utilized in this particular manner of data transfer is mainly connection driven, thus readily joining the two end points with virtual circuit prior to the data starting to transmit.
Asynchronous transfer mode technology will easily be used for mainly LAN and WAN links. ATM additionally has several other distinctive capabilities that are mentioned briefly as listed here:
It has the possibility of providing a data transfer rate of as much as 2.5 GBps which effortlessly aids high bandwidth distributed programs. This is primarily useful for video-on-demand techniques or video conferencing that are frequently based on the latest distributed software. It also helps access to remote databases including multimedia information.
Where traffic is concerned, asynchronous transfer mode specifically uses a virtual network to drive data within different locations. In addition to point to point communications, ATM is also beneficial where an individual transmitter and a number of receiver services are concerned due to its multicasting capability.
